Some secrets are buried for a reason.
Some are weaponised.
When a high-ranking Metropolitan Police whistleblower is found dead in a locked room, the case is ruled a suicide before the body is cold. Evidence vanishes. Files are sealed. And the truth is buried beneath institutional silence.
Bestselling true-crime author Clara Vance knows better.
Desperate for answers, she turns to the only man ruthless enough to find them - Elias Thorne, a disgraced former intelligence officer turned private investigator with a reputation for operating in the shadows. Hacking. Breaking in. Asking questions no one wants answered.
Their search uncovers a secret whispered through centuries: The Solomon Cipher - a lost 14th-century manuscript rumoured to conjure gold, but in reality hiding something far more dangerous. A mathematical key capable of breaching modern blockchain encryption. A tool that could collapse economies, dismantle governments, and rewrite global power overnight.
From the rain-slicked streets of London to occult chambers beneath Rome, from a shadow auction in glittering Dubai to a remote temple in Japan, Elias and Clara are drawn into a silent war between rival crime syndicates, corrupt intelligence agencies, and factions within international law enforcement.
But the greatest threat may not be the Cipher.
It may be Elias himself.
As betrayals surface and loyalties fracture, Clara begins to question whether the man she loves is protecting her... or manipulating the entire global crisis for reasons of his own.
And when the Cipher is finally destroyed - or so she believes - one last revelation changes everything.
Because some conspiracies aren't uncovered.
They're engineered.
